Once you have found yourself in **tropical paradise**, are you ready to extend the dream? While one **island** is amazing, sometimes more is more. You might consider island-hopping. Many regions offer the opportunity to visit multiple **islands** within a single **vacation**. The Caribbean, for instance, offers numerous **islands** within easy reach. The best way to island-hop is to plan your itinerary. Research the **islands** you're interested in and how to get between them. Consider the distances, transportation options (such as ferries or short flights), and the amount of time you want to spend on each **island**. Make sure to book accommodations and transport in advance, especially during peak season. You can also mix **island** time with exploring other areas. Combine your **island vacation** with a stay on the mainland to add a new layer to your trip. You can combine it with a city break, or **explore** national parks and other natural attractions. Maybe you want to **explore** the rainforests of Costa Rica, or the cultural sites of Mexico? Your trip will expand beyond the **beach**. Think about your interests and preferences, and tailor your itinerary accordingly. This is your chance to create a once-in-a-lifetime **adventure**. If you’re a **travel** enthusiast, consider visiting multiple locations. This will allow you to see the best of different worlds, from the **sun**-kissed **beaches** to the vibrant city life. When planning your trip, consider how much time you have and how far you're willing to go. Look into flights and transportation to and from your other locations. The world is your oyster, so plan accordingly to maximize your time. Whether you choose to **explore** multiple **islands** or combine your **island vacation** with other destinations, the key is to customize your **travel** experience to your liking. Embrace the flexibility and create an unforgettable trip that reflects your individual interests and desires. The **sun** is calling, so let's start planning!

Okay, so we know the *Black Death* was a big deal, but how did it actually work? The BBC does a fantastic job explaining the science behind the plague, making it accessible even if you're not a science whiz. As I mentioned, the culprit was *Yersinia pestis*, a bacteria that thrives in fleas. These fleas, in turn, hitched rides on rats, which carried the bacteria. When the rats died (and they died in droves), the fleas jumped onto other animals, including humans, spreading the plague. The BBC explores the transmission cycle in detail. They show how fleas bite infected rodents, ingest the bacteria, and then, when they bite humans, transmit the disease. It's a truly horrifying, yet fascinating, chain of events. They also delve into the different forms of the plague: bubonic, pneumonic, and septicemic. The bubonic plague is what most people think of. It causes the characteristic buboes, the painful swellings in the lymph nodes. The pneumonic plague attacks the lungs, causing pneumonia. The septicemic plague infects the bloodstream. Each form has its own set of symptoms and its own rate of transmission. The BBC explains these differences, helping viewers understand how the disease progressed. One of the most interesting aspects of the BBC's scientific coverage is the use of modern technology to study the *Black Death*. They often use techniques like DNA analysis to trace the origins of the plague and to understand how it spread. This cutting-edge science brings a whole new dimension to the historical narrative. The BBC also explores the limitations of medieval medicine. They highlight how people didn't understand the cause of the disease or how it spread. Treatments were often ineffective, and people resorted to superstitious practices. This is a stark reminder of how far medicine has come. The scientific analysis also includes discussions of how the plague might have mutated over time. Scientists now believe that *Yersinia pestis* may have evolved, changing its virulence and transmission patterns. The BBC presents these complex scientific ideas in a way that's easy to grasp. They use clear explanations, diagrams, and sometimes even animations to illustrate the scientific concepts. So, even if you're not a science guru, you can still follow along. The BBC frequently consults with leading scientists and medical experts. This means the information is accurate and up-to-date. They also show the work of archaeologists who have found mass graves and studied the remains of plague victims. This gives a physical representation to the science, making it even more compelling. The science behind the *Black Death* helps us understand not just the disease itself, but also the societal responses. It explains the quarantine measures, the attempts at treatment, and the ways people tried to cope with the plague's devastating effects. The BBC's in-depth scientific analysis is an essential part of its coverage of the *Black Death*. It provides viewers with a comprehensive understanding of the disease, its transmission, and its impact on the world. It’s seriously good stuff!
